Let Your Dim Light Shine was released in 1995 as the big follow-up to the 1990s alternative rock milestone Grave Dancers Union, which featured their biggest hit Runaway Train. Once again did the band achieve platinum status, with three singles hitting the charts. 'Misery' even reached #20 in the US Billboard Top 100 and was even parodied by 'Weird Al' Yankovic, probably the best indicator of being a huge band in 1990s.
The album was produced by Butch Vigs, who produced Nevermind (Nirvana), and helped to keep the signature alternative sound of the band´s previous albums intact.
